Energy intensity level of primary energy in Solomon Islands
Solomon Islands: Energy intensity level of primary energy was 5.02 MJ/$2005 PPP in 2015. ▼ Falling
Energy intensity level of primary energy in Solomon Islands, 1990–2015
Source: World Bank and International Energy Agency (IEA Statistics © OECD/IEA, http://www.iea.org/stats/index.asp). Measured in MJ/$2005 PPP.
Analysis
In 2015, energy intensity level of primary energy in Solomon Islands stood at 5.02 MJ/$2005 PPP. That is the lowest value across all 26 years on record.
The figure is down 5.8% on the previous year and down 32.7% over ten years.
Over the whole period, energy intensity level of primary energy in Solomon Islands peaked at 9.4 MJ/$2005 PPP in 1990 and was at its lowest, 5.02 MJ/$2005 PPP, in 2015.
That places Solomon Islands 76th out of 192 countries with data for 2015, putting it in the middle of the range.
The long-run direction has been consistently falling across the 26 years of available data.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1990s | 7.23 MJ/$2005 PPP | 6.31 MJ/$2005 PPP | 9.4 MJ/$2005 PPP | 10 |
| 2000s | 7.5 MJ/$2005 PPP | 6.33 MJ/$2005 PPP | 8.64 MJ/$2005 PPP | 10 |
| 2010s | 5.54 MJ/$2005 PPP | 5.02 MJ/$2005 PPP | 6.39 MJ/$2005 PPP | 6 |

About this data
Energy intensity level of primary energy (MJ/$2005 PPP): A ratio between energy supply and gross domestic product measured at purchasing power parity. Energy intensity is an indication of how much energy is used to produce one unit of economic output. Lower ratio indicates that less energy is used to produce one unit of output.
